“Food poisoning” and “stomach bug” are informal terms describing gastroenteritis (inflammation of the stomach lining and intestines). While they share some symptoms, their causes differ.
While food poisoning from spoiled or improperly prepared food may be the culprit responsible for your GI woes, you’re just as likely to be dealing with a stomach bug.
